There was some discussion among Lowndes County Commissioners,
but their Regular Session on Tuesday, April 28, 2026, as they
approved all the voting items unanimously.

In her Reports,
County Manager Paige Dukes called on both Utilities Director Steve Stalvy and Fire Chief Billy Young about the current drought and fire situations.

Six Citizens Wished to Be Heard.


George Fisher spoke about his water research
, which includes he’s discovered
the line of sinkholes running across the county.


Pam Kelly Jarvis
and

Amanda Hall

spoke about animal issues.

Jimmy LeFiles,

Michael Noll
,
and

Susan Wehling

spoke about datacenters.


[Collage @ LCC 28 April 2026]


Collage @ LCC 28 April 2026

After the meeting adjourned, County Chairman Bill Slaughter came down to talk to several people about datacenters.
County Manager Paige Dukes joined in.
The Chairman said it was their procedure not to answer Citizens Wishing to Be Heard during the meeting, but he made himself available afterwards.

There was a somewhat startling citizen report about the possible future datacenter site at the Tuesday evening Regular Session of the Lowndes County Commission.
See
other post for Tetiana Babcock
.

The Commissioners breezed through all the voting items with unanimous approval.
Except Commissioner Joyce Evans did

ask if any applicants for the board appointments were present
.
Travis Cox was present.
He had just been

appointed to ZBOA
in place of John Hogan.
Also, John McCall was reappointed to ZBOA.

County Manager Paige Dukes asked for

Ashley Tye to talk about Water Stewardship
in the current drought,
and

Fire Chief Billy Young
to talk about not burning while it is so dry.

Six citizens spoke:

Mary Roe about Paving of Green Road
,

Kelly Saxon about Baldwin Place grants and shelters
,

Amanda Hall about pet Breeding limits
,

Kristina Cheek McBride about Maternal Health Issues
,

Michael Noll about Data Center collaboration and transparency
,
and

Tetiana Babcock about Data Center Encroachment
.
